Tulip Tree belongs to the family Magnoliaceae and Southernwood belongs to the family Asteraceae.

Also, when you compare Tulip Tree and Southernwood,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Liriodendron and other plant's genus is Artemisia. Tulip Tree tribe is Not Available and Southernwood tribe is Anthemideae. Tulip Tree clade is Angiosperms and Magnoliids and order is Magnoliales whereas Southernwood clade is Angiosperms, Asterids and Eudicots and order is Asterales. Every plant have subfamilies.
